How often should the brake fluid be replaced for Haval H6?

3 Answers
CollinLynn
07/28/25 4:31pm
Haval H6 brake fluid should be replaced every 40,000 kilometers. Brake fluid, also known as hydraulic brake fluid, is the liquid medium that transmits braking pressure in hydraulic braking systems and is used in vehicles equipped with hydraulic braking systems. I think the brake fluid replacement interval for the Haval H6 is typically every 2 years or around 40,000 kilometers, whichever comes first. This is based on my own experience of driving for over a decade. If you neglect this, the braking system might develop issues, such as the pedal feeling softer or the stopping distance becoming longer. Over time, brake fluid tends to absorb moisture, which lowers its boiling point and reduces braking efficiency during high-temperature driving. In severe cases, it can even corrode the brake calipers or master cylinder, leading to costly repairs. I recommend having the technician check the fluid's color and moisture content during every maintenance service. If it appears dark or cloudy, it might need an early replacement. Don’t cut corners—safety comes first. Spending a few hundred yuan to replace it will give you peace of mind while driving.

As for the brake fluid of the Haval H6, the manual recommends replacing it every two years or 40,000 kilometers, and I've been following that—it's quite hassle-free. Over the years of driving, I've noticed that skipping scheduled replacements accelerates brake system aging. For instance, moisture buildup in the fluid lines can make the pedal feel heavy during hot-weather hill climbs or sudden braking, increasing the risk of failure. During routine parking checks, if the fluid reservoir appears transparent, it's still good; a brownish tint signals it's time for a change. The cost is low but saves hefty repair bills later. Stick to regular maintenance—don’t wait for issues to arise. After each replacement, the brakes feel more responsive, making driving much more reassuring.

What transmission is used in the Tiida car?

Tiida is equipped with two types of transmissions: one is a 5-speed manual transmission, and the other is a CVT transmission. The CVT transmission consists of two cone pulleys and a steel belt inside, which can move along the pulleys, allowing the transmission to vary speed and torque. The CVT transmission offers good reliability and durability, along with a simple structure, compact size, and lightweight. The Tiida is a vehicle produced by Dongfeng Nissan Passenger Vehicle Company, featuring the newly developed HR16DE engine jointly developed by Nissan and Renault. It incorporates technologies such as variable valve timing and double overhead camshafts, with an all-aluminum inline four-cylinder layout, delivering exceptional power performance.

What is the difference between 2.0L and 2.0T?

2.0T and 2.0L differ in engine performance and maintenance. Both 2.0 refer to the engine displacement, where T stands for turbocharged engine and L represents a naturally aspirated engine. Below are the specific differences between 2.0T and 2.0L in terms of engine performance and maintenance: Performance differences between 2.0T and 2.0L: The 2.0T turbocharged engine increases intake pressure and volume through a turbocharging device, which also increases the fuel injected into the cylinders. This expands the engine's maximum torque range, enhancing vehicle acceleration but also increasing fuel consumption. Maintenance differences between 2.0T and 2.0L: Turbocharged engines generally incur higher maintenance costs compared to naturally aspirated engines. Additionally, among engines of the same displacement, turbocharged engines tend to consume more fuel.

What is the tire size of the Kia K2?

Kia K2 uses two different sizes of tires, one is 185/65r15, and the other is 195/55r16. The specifications of the tires are written on the side, for example, 205/55r16 means the tire width is 205 mm, the aspect ratio is 55, the R stands for radial tire, and 16 means it is mounted on a 16-inch rim.
